Studying Physical Technology as an international student prepares you to apply principles of physics to develop and operate modern technological systems across industry and research. The program combines applied physics with engineering disciplines such as optics, electronics, materials science, measurement technology, and energy systems, supported by extensive laboratory work and practical projects. Germany and other leading study destinations offer strong practice-oriented programs with close collaboration between universities, research institutes, and high-tech companies.

NC-Free
Refers to study programs without admission restrictions. All applicants who meet the basic entry requirements are admitted, as there is no limit to the number of available places.
